Studies of nucleation, coherent tilt and surface phase transitions by molecular beam epitaxy

Abstract

dc:description

High-quality single crystals and alloys have been synthesized by molecular beam epitaxy (MBE). These crystals were employed to study the nucleation and strain relief processes during epitaxial growth, as well as phenomena of surface order-disorder transformations.
